Extended Data Fig. 3: Reconstitution of NCPs and mature neutrophils in BMs of allogeneic HSC-transplanted patients.
From: CD66b−CD64dimCD115− cells in the human bone marrow represent neutrophil-committed progenitors

Flow cytometry strategy for the identification of reconstituting neutrophils (green), eosinophils (pink), NCP1s (orange), NCP2s (green), NCP3s (magenta), NCP4s (turquoise), cMoPs (light blue), MDPs (brown) and pre-monocytes (black) within BM-LDCs of reconstituting BM (at day +21) from a patient undergoing allogeneic hematopoietic stem cell transplantation (alloHSCT) (n = 3).
